I would not have compromised on drilling the wire holes the just fit. I would have drilled them larger right away and ran the grommets. Not because it looks nicer, but to prevent chaffing of the wire insulation, prevent arcing and potential fire. Still though I like this build a lot.
I was thinking the same thing. Those holes will cut through the insulators pretty quick.

I own a 12 foot Deep Lake Jon Boat and took the back seat and middle seat out plugging the holes left in the hull with rivets. The side live well came built in the boat when I bought it. Used wood strip backing underneath and put plywood in the front and back floor and attached a pedestal and seat to sit on. The plywood squares can lift out of the boat. Simple pond hopper bass fishing boat. With a built in live well from the original boat design. This reduces weight so l can pull it over from pit to pit or farm pond and fish in comfort. Using a simple battery powered trolling motor. And aluminum shaft oars as a fail safe back up plan to move the boat in the water. Primitive but effective.

putting the batteries in the stern is a bad idea. i have a 1236, when i run with 1 battery in the stern my bow is ass high in the air. any wind will catch the bow. an throw me into a spin turn, turning me 180 degrees. recommend moving the batteries to the bow too balance out the weight carried. 2 batts at 65 lb each vs my 250 in the stern.
